Just out of interest, what is happening to all the RAF Jags. Are they all being scrapped or have some been saved for museums this time, unlike the Phantoms?
wardy_fingers
Nov 10 2007, 11:00 AM
All the last service jags from 6 Sqn were flown into Cosford along with spares to become ground trainers for new techies also parts were stripped by me and a few others at cosford to be fitted onto other airframes in the Airforce, the Gr3a is a totally different beast to the 1's its Avionics suite is by no means least an impressive bit of kit, I've worked on for 5 years and for its age the Avionics is damn good and at least got a +90% serviceability rate, and as its the most modern bit of demobed kit it makes perfect sense to train new techies on them.
